CODENAME CHEROKEE

(A 1500 word excerpt from THE ATOMIC TIMES: My H-Bomb Year at the Pacific Proving Ground)


Cherokee was the second of 17 nuclear blasts in the 1956 United States H-bomb test series, Operation Redwing, conducted in the South Pacific. Cherokee was typical of what happened when over 1600 men (including me) became guinea pigs for the Department of Defense.  The unstated motto at the Pentagon was:  Everything that CAN go wrong WILL go wrong.


And it did. Cherokee was a prime example.
